The ingredients needed to make Lemon-Pepper Chickpea Fattoush:
  1. Take 1 pita, torn I to pieces
  2. Prepare 3 Tbsp. fresh lemon juice
  3. Get 1/3 C. Olive oil
  4. Prepare 1/2 tsp. Lemon-pepper
  5. Take 1/4 tsp. Salt
  6. Make ready 2 Romain hearts, chopped
  7. Get 1/2 can chickpeas
  8. Take 1 tomato, chopped
  9. Prepare 1/2 cucumber, peeled, cut in half horizontally and chopped

Instructions to make Lemon-Pepper Chickpea Fattoush:
  1. Preheat oven to 400°F.
  2. Mix lemon juice, olive oil, salt and lemon-pepper in small bowl.
  3. Place torn pita pieces on a cookie sheet in even layer. Drizzle with 3 Tbsp. of the dressing. Toss to coat. Place in oven until browned and crisp. About 5 minutes.
  4. Place chickpeas, tomato and cucumber in remaining dressing.
  5. Arrange chopped salad on 2 plates and top with chickpeas, tomato and cucumber dressing mixture evenly.
  6. Sprinkle toasted pita pieces between dishes and toss to coat.
